The legislative body of Westland is the City Council. The City Council is charged with a number of tasks, including, but not limited to:
- Approval of the yearly City budget
- Authorize the borrowing of funds through bonds
- Approval of City expenditures
- Enacting City ordinances
- Modifying the City Charter
All meetings are open to the public and rules of the Council provide citizens a reasonable opportunity to be heard.
